Output 58a048ec77b28a9c550fcf36a3be83c170c073c80817a131e07d15f6e3438301:4

value
503275881
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8902db43f48739fa205890749b4fe2208109acdb OP_EQUALVERIFY OP_CHECKSIG
address
1DVSzkkLGq3cF4rW7DAEvZ3HuGn4TVQ1Fg
transaction
58a048ec77b28a9c550fcf36a3be83c170c073c80817a131e07d15f6e3438301
spent
true